Action-Packed Adventures on Game Pass
For those adventure seekers and thrill-enthusiasts, Game Pass is overflowing with titles that promise to keep you on the edge of your seat. First up, we have “Halo Infinite,” the latest installment in the legendary Halo saga. Stepping into the boots of Master Chief, you're thrown into a sprawling open world brimming with alien threats and compelling mysteries. The combat is as polished as ever, the story is captivating, and the multiplayer is downright addictive. If you're a fan of first-person shooters, this is an absolute must-play. Then there's the gritty and immersive world of “Gears 5.” This third-person shooter takes you through stunning landscapes as you battle the Locust horde. The visceral combat, coupled with a deeply emotional story, makes it a standout title. Not to mention the game looks absolutely gorgeous, showcasing the power of modern consoles and PCs. But wait, there’s more! If you crave something with a touch of the fantastical, “Sea of Thieves” might just be your cup of grog. This swashbuckling adventure lets you live out your pirate dreams, sailing the high seas, hunting for treasure, and battling rival crews. The sense of freedom is unparalleled, and the emergent gameplay ensures that every voyage is a unique experience. And let’s not forget “Assassin's Creed Odyssey” and “Assassin's Creed Origins,” both of which offer massive open worlds to explore, filled with historical intrigue and thrilling combat scenarios. Whether you’re scaling the pyramids of Egypt or sailing the Aegean Sea, these games offer hundreds of hours of content. These action-packed adventures are not just games; they are experiences. They transport you to different worlds, let you embody heroic characters, and create memories that last long after you’ve put down the controller. Indie Gems and Hidden Treasures on Game Pass
Beyond the AAA blockbusters, Game Pass shines in its collection of indie games, often unearthing hidden treasures that offer unique and memorable experiences. Indie games frequently push the boundaries of game design, providing fresh ideas and artistic flair that you won’t find anywhere else. One standout title is “Hollow Knight,” a mesmerizing Metroidvania that combines challenging combat with a beautifully realized world. Exploring the decaying kingdom of Hallownest is a joy in itself, and the intricate level design encourages exploration and discovery. The combat is precise and rewarding, and the boss battles are epic tests of skill. If you’re a fan of dark fantasy and challenging gameplay, “Hollow Knight” is an absolute must-play. Then there’s the narrative masterpiece that is “What Remains of Edith Finch.” This walking simulator tells the poignant story of a family cursed with untimely deaths. Each family member's story is told through a unique gameplay mechanic, making for a deeply emotional and unforgettable experience. It’s a game that stays with you long after you’ve finished it. For those who crave a bit of platforming action, “Celeste” is a brilliant choice. This game tells the story of Madeline as she climbs Celeste Mountain, battling her inner demons along the way. The platforming is incredibly precise, and the game’s difficulty is balanced perfectly, offering a rewarding challenge without being overly frustrating. The story is also surprisingly touching, dealing with themes of anxiety and self-acceptance. And let’s not forget the cooperative cooking chaos of “Overcooked! 2.” This game is a hilarious and stressful experience as you and your friends try to prepare meals in increasingly absurd kitchens. Communication is key, and the frantic gameplay is guaranteed to create some memorable moments. These indie gems offer something different. RPG Adventures and Story-Driven Epics
For those who love to immerse themselves in rich stories and develop their characters, Game Pass offers a fantastic selection of RPG adventures. These games often feature deep narratives, branching storylines, and a whole lot of character customization, allowing you to truly make your mark on the game world. One of the crown jewels of Game Pass's RPG offerings is the “Fallout” series. Whether you're exploring the post-apocalyptic wasteland of “Fallout 4” or the vibrant world of “Fallout: New Vegas” (available through backward compatibility), these games offer hundreds of hours of content. The freedom to explore, the deep character customization, and the branching storylines make for incredibly engaging experiences. Each playthrough feels unique, and you'll find yourself making tough choices that have lasting consequences. Another standout RPG series on Game Pass is “The Elder Scrolls.” “The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im” is a true masterpiece, offering a massive open world to explore, filled with dragons, dungeons, and countless quests. The sense of freedom is unparalleled, and you can truly become anyone you want in this world. Whether you're a noble warrior, a stealthy thief, or a powerful mage, “Skyrim” has something for everyone. And let’s not forget the critically acclaimed “Mass Effect” series, available through EA Play (which is included with Xbox Game Pass Ultimate). These sci-fi RPGs tell an epic story of intergalactic conflict, with memorable characters, compelling storylines, and tough choices to make. The relationships you build with your squadmates are just as important as the battles you fight, making for a deeply engaging experience. For those who prefer a more action-oriented RPG experience, “Kingdoms of Amalur: Re-Reckoning” is a great choice. This game offers a fast-paced combat system, a deep character customization system, and a sprawling world to explore. It’s a perfect blend of action and RPG elements. Family-Friendly Fun and Co-Op Games
Game Pass isn't just for solo adventurers; it also boasts a fantastic collection of family-friendly and co-op games that are perfect for playing with friends and loved ones. These games emphasize teamwork, communication, and good old-fashioned fun, making them ideal for game nights or casual play sessions. One of the standout co-op experiences on Game Pass is “It Takes Two.” This game is designed exclusively for two players, and it tells the heartwarming story of a couple going through a divorce. The gameplay is incredibly varied, with each level introducing new mechanics and challenges that require teamwork and communication to overcome. It’s a game that will bring you closer together, both in the game and in real life. Another excellent co-op choice is “Minecraft Dungeons.” This dungeon-crawler spin-off of Minecraft offers a more accessible and streamlined experience than the original game, making it perfect for younger players or those new to the genre. The gameplay is simple but addictive, and the cooperative aspect adds a whole new layer of fun. For family-friendly fun, look no further than the “Forza Horizon” series. These open-world racing games offer stunning graphics, a vast array of cars to drive, and a sense of freedom that’s hard to match. The games are accessible to players of all skill levels, and the cooperative modes allow you to explore the world and race together with friends and family. And let’s not forget the party game madness of “Moving Out 2.” This physics-based game tasks you with moving furniture out of houses in the most chaotic and hilarious way possible. The cooperative gameplay is guaranteed to create some laugh-out-loud moments, and the game is perfect for parties or gatherings. Sports and Racing Games to Get Your Heart Pumping
For those with a need for speed or a love of competition, Game Pass provides a thrilling assortment of sports and racing games. These titles offer adrenaline-pumping action, realistic gameplay, and plenty of opportunities to test your skills against friends, rivals, or the computer. Leading the pack is the “Forza Horizon” series, with titles like “Forza Horizon 5” setting a new standard for open-world racing games. The stunning visuals, the vast and diverse landscapes of Mexico, and the sheer number of cars to collect and customize make for an unparalleled racing experience. Whether you're tearing through the desert, drifting around corners in the city, or racing down a coastal highway, “Forza Horizon 5” delivers thrills at every turn. For those who prefer the precision and challenge of simulation racing, the “Forza Motorsport” series offers a more realistic driving experience. These games focus on the technical aspects of racing, with detailed car customization options, realistic physics, and challenging tracks to master. If you’re a true gearhead, you’ll love the depth and authenticity of “Forza Motorsport.” If sports are more your thing, Game Pass also includes access to EA Sports titles through EA Play. This means you can dive into the world of soccer with “FIFA,” hit the gridiron with “Madden NFL,” or step onto the ice with “NHL.” These games offer realistic gameplay, deep franchise modes, and plenty of online competition, making them perfect for sports fans. And let’s not forget the indie gem “Descenders,” a downhill mountain biking game that combines fast-paced action with procedurally generated tracks. Each run is a unique challenge, and the game’s physics-based gameplay is both rewarding and challenging.
